Product Overview: LTC2901-2CGN
The LTC2901-2CGN is a highly sophisticated quad voltage monitor designed by Linear Technology, now part of Analog Devices, to ensure the reliability and stability of electronic systems. This precision monitoring device is crucial for applications that require simultaneous supervision of multiple supply voltages.
Key Features
- Multiple Voltage Thresholds: The LTC2901-2CGN is capable of monitoring four different voltage thresholds, making it versatile for various system requirements.
- Adjustable Reset Timeout: It offers an adjustable reset timeout period, allowing users to set the duration for which the reset condition is maintained.
- Wide Operating Voltage Range: The device operates over a wide voltage range, accommodating different types of power supplies and voltage levels.
- Low Power Consumption: Designed for power-sensitive applications, the LTC2901-2CGN consumes minimal power, which helps in extending the battery life of portable devices.
- Guaranteed Reset Output: The monitor guarantees a valid reset output down to VCC = 1V, ensuring reliable operation even during low voltage conditions.

Product Specifications
The LTC2901-2CGN comes in a 16-lead narrow SSOP package and is designed for commercial and industrial temperature ranges. With its precision voltage monitoring and robust feature set, this device is a critical component for systems that cannot afford voltage-related failures.
